This is an open offer to any 2007/8 G37 owner. Stick OR auto. So Cal G37s are preferred for local Dyno tuning..

TechnoSquare Inc., the leader in Nissan ECU Reflashing, is looking for G37 (VQ37HR) owners that want to help out in beta testing their 07 program. They have the JDM ecu data completed, but now they need US spec cars to generate their ECU program.

Be the first to optimize the VQ37HR engine! typical changes to the stock ECU program are:

Rev Limiter Increase,
Speed LImiter Deletion
Ignition Timing advance/retard, Ignition timing switch over
Air Fuel Ratio Optimization
Throttle body control/response
and much more!

TechnoSquare is offering two free reflashes to anyone that lets them use the ECU for prototyping purposes. Your car will be down for approx. two weeks since the ECU needs to be removed from the car and sent to Japan for data downloading. Your ecu will be returned safely to you, guaranteed.

If you're Local to So Cal, once the Technos ECU tuning is complete, you'll get custom tune done on their Chassis Load-based Dyno here in shop, and next time, whenever you decide to add a modification such as a plenum or exhaust or whatever, that 2nd reflash will also be for free.

If you are OUT OF STATE (outside CA) and would like to help out, you still will get the two free ECU reflashes and as soon as we get a local G37 to get on the Dyno in the shop.
